Window Casing Repair in Denver County, CO
Window casing repair services address issues related to the decorative trim surrounding windows, including the frames and moldings that enhance both appearance and functionality. This service covers a variety of projects such as fixing damaged or rotting wood, replacing cracked or missing casing, and restoring the original finish to improve the curb appeal and energy efficiency of a property. Homeowners often seek this service when window casings have sustained weather damage, show signs of deterioration, or no longer align properly with the window frame, affecting insulation and security.
Before requesting window casing repair, property owners typically want to understand the scope of work involved, including whether existing trim can be restored or needs replacement. It’s also helpful to consider the materials used, such as wood, vinyl, or composite, and how they match the current style of the home. Clarifying the extent of damage and the desired aesthetic outcome can assist in planning repairs that enhance both the appearance and durability of the window area.

Common Window Casing Repair Jobs
Window casing repair involves fixing damaged or rotting trim around windows to restore appearance and function.
Cracked or split casing work addresses issues caused by weather or impact to prevent further damage.
Rot repair focuses on removing and replacing decayed wood to maintain window integrity.
Re-casing projects update outdated or worn window trim to enhance curb appeal.
Water damage repair addresses leaks that cause swelling or deterioration of window casings.
Custom casing restoration involves matching existing trim styles for seamless repairs.
Window Casing Repair Questions
What is window casing repair? It involves fixing or replacing the trim around a window to improve appearance and function.
When should window casing be repaired? Repair is needed if the casing is damaged, rotting, or has gaps that affect insulation and aesthetics.
What types of damage can be fixed with casing repair? Common issues include wood rot, cracks, warping, and nail or screw holes.
How can damaged window casing be identified? Signs include peeling paint, visible cracks, warping, or gaps between the casing and window frame.
